加入收藏 | 设为首页 | RSS
您当前的位置:首页 > 在线留言

响应式布局和自适应布局详解

时间:04-03  来源:本站  作者:
  布局中你却得考虑上百种不同的状态

  布局中你却得考虑上百种不同的状态。虽然绝大部分状态差异较小,但仍然也算做差异。它使得把握设计最终效果变得更难,同样让布局更加的难以测试和预测。但同时说难,这也算是响应式布局美的所在。在考虑到表层级别不确定因素的过程中,你也会因此更好的掌握一些基础知识。当然,要做到精确到像素级别的去预测设943*684像素视区里的样子是很难的,但是你至少可以很轻松的确定它是能够正常工作的,因为页面的基本特性和布局结构都是根据语义结构来部署的。

  Responsive design,意在实现不同屏幕分辨率的终端上浏览网页的不同展示方式。通过响应式设计能使网站在手机和平板电脑上有更好的浏览阅读体验。

  大多数移动浏览器将HTML页面放大为宽的视图(viewport)以符合屏幕分辨率。你可以使用视图的meta标签来进行重置。下面的视图标签告诉浏览器,使用设备的宽度作为视图宽度并禁止初始的缩放。在head标签里加入这个meta标签。

  它根据条件告诉浏览器如何为指定视图宽度渲染页面。假如一个终端的分辨率小于 980px,那么可以这样写:

  例如pre,iframe,video等,都需要和img一样控制好宽度。对于table,建议不要增加 padding 属性,低分辨率下使用内容居中:

  Morten Hjerde和他的同事们对2005至2008年市场中的400余种移动设备进行了统计(查看报告),下图展示了大致的统计结果:

  我们可以监测页面布局随着不同的浏览环境而产生的变化,如果它们变的过窄过短或是过宽过长,则通过一个子级样式表来继承主样式表的设定,并专门针对某些布局结构进行样式覆写。我们来看下代码示例:

  图中上半部分是大屏幕设备所显示的完整页面,下面的则是该页面在小屏幕设备的呈现方式。页面HTML代码如下:

  Ethan的文章中的“Meet the media query”部分有更多的范例及解释。更有效率的做法是,将多个media queries整合在一个样式表文件中

  自适应布局给了你更多设计的空间,因为你只用考虑几种不同的状态。而在响应式布局中你却得考虑上百种不同的状态。虽然绝大部分状态差异较小,但仍然也算做差异。它使得把握设计最终效果变得更难,同样让响应式布局更加的难以测试和预测。但同时说难,这也算是响应式布局美的所在。在考虑到表层级别不确定因素的过程中,你也会因此更好的掌握一些基础知识。当然,要做到精确到像素级别的去预测设943*684像素视区里的样子是很难的,但是你至少可以很轻松的确定它是能够正常工作的,因为页面的基本特性和布局结构都是根据语义结构来部署的。

广告
上一篇:笑脸墙班务墙留言墙教室布置展板设计
下一篇:成都微信小程序开发-成都网站建设-响应式网站制作-成都网站公司
广告
推荐
最新
  1. 成都微信小程序开发-成都网站建设-响应式网
  2. 响应式布局和自适应布局详解
  3. 笑脸墙班务墙留言墙教室布置展板设计
  4. 同学情谊句子
  5. 描写同学情谊的经典句子
  6. 响应式布局
  7. 扫二维码留言墙提意见AI矢量图模板
  8. 鐣欒█澧欒璁
  9. 成都宽窄巷子的“留言墙”成独特风景
  10. 魔道祖师:激动!告白墙上看到道友留言“魏无羡
热门
  1. 长江网武汉城市留言板首场“区长在线互动”
  2. 成都男子为获免费鸭肠发朋友圈 领导留言旷
  3. 北京功能全面的在线聊天系统怎么申请
  4. 在线英语培训:外贸人士如何更高效的工作?
  5. 日本最大视频网站直播阅兵式 留言超过12万
  6. 哒哒英语海外招聘低门槛 野鸡外教也能变身
  7. QQ华夏迎资料片送祝福 留言免费送Q币
  8. 12个ppt素材网站主要是免费先收藏以备不时
  9. 安徽省教育厅厅长6月24日上午接受高招在线
  10. 女子花一万多购买在线英语课程 结果却遇上